Output 41660edb7cd11bb969f9199f346ca770f3f8f295e0a39d93cb2318d6fc96750a:68

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 d0de26b11cdb68e315e0c4289c22213345ea6e1a
address
bc1q6r0zdvgumd5wx90qcs5fcg3pxdz75ms6ctfff4
transaction
41660edb7cd11bb969f9199f346ca770f3f8f295e0a39d93cb2318d6fc96750a
spent
true